Capillaries are the tiniest blood vessels that link up arteries to the veins. If these capillaries thins or broadens extensively, the small capillary walls can be destroyed thus blood will leak out resulting to the formation of small red purple lines on your skin. Even if these lines are not agonizing in nature, they can be disappointing in appearance; that is why laser treatments are recommended to eliminate broken capillaries.
Broken capillaries take place on the skin that is most sensitive or flimsy like the cheeks and nose. The causes of broken capillaries are attributed to hot temperature, intense winds, sunburn, traumatic conditions on the face like rosacea and even dehydrated skin. Laser treatment is considered as the most efficient means of treating broken capillaries if all of other natural remedies did not work. Here are several types of laser treatment for broken capillaries.
How to Use Laser Treatment for Broken Capillaries
Laser Treatment 1: The laser light
People with broken capillaries are given laser treatment that aims to repair the condition. The laser light energy is focused on the aimed vein. The energy is transmitted from the laser to the vein and soaked up by the blood vessels thus resulting to unclogging of the vessels that no longer transmit blood and removing the look of broken capillaries.
Laser Treatment 2: Pulsed-Dye Lasers
This is the most usual kind of laser being utilized to remedy broken capillaries. This is also established as a V-beam laser that can remedy an assortment of skin problems like birthmarks, acne scars, port wine stains and spider veins as well. This kind of laser is believed to transmit a moderately effortless rupture of energy, and the laser light performs to freshen the exterior coating of the skin while aiming at injured blood vessels beneath the skin.
Laser Treatment 3: Laser surgery
This kind of laser treatment utilizes a light beam that aims to eliminate the bleeding blood vessels or injured tissues. It remedies tissues through heating the aimed cells until they erupted. Aside from treating broken capillaries, it is also used to treat other types of skin imperfections like marks, sun spots, wrinkles and scars.
Laser Treatment 4: Intense Pulsed-laser
The intense pulsed light system uses a huge field of wavelengths that are considered ideal for the remedy of an assortment of problems together with the exclusion of spots and blood vessels as well. The light is absorbed by the blood in evident vessels and transformed into heat resulting to the shrinkage of broken capillaries.
Laser Treatment 5: Long-pulsed YAG Laser
This kind of laser treatment can penetrate deeply into the skin due to its extended wavelength effect that can reach up to1064 nm. This type of laser treatment is advantageous in treating larger and deeper telangiectatic vessels.
Laser for broken capillaries requires long session particularly if the problem is intense and had already broadened. The smaller broken capillaries may only need single treatment session, but the extensive ones need several treatments. Each laser treatment sessions usually take more or less 30 minutes.
